▼
MSDN Library Visual Studio 6.0
▶
Welcome to the MSDN Library
▶
Visual Studio Documentation
▶
Visual Basic Documentation
▶
Visual C++ Documentation
▶
Visual FoxPro Documentation
▶
Visual InterDev Documentation
▶
Visual J++ Documentation
▶
Visual SourceSafe Documentation
▶
Tools and Technologies
▶
Microsoft Office Development
▼
Platform SDK
▶
What's New?
▶
Windows Programming Guidelines
▶
Database and Messaging Services
▶
Graphics and Multimedia Services
▶
Internet/Intranet/Extranet Services
▶
Networking and Distributed Services
▶
COM and ActiveX Object Services
▶
Setup and Systems Management Services
▶
User Interface Services
▼
Windows Base Services
▶
Microsoft Cluster Server
▶
Smart Card
▶
CryptoAPI 2.0
▶
Cryptographic Service Providers
▶
Certificate Server
▶
Debugging and Error Handling
▶
Executables
▶
Files and I/O
▶
General Library
▶
Hardware
▶
International Features
▶
Interprocess Communication
▶
Removable Storage Manager Programmer's Reference
▶
Security
▼
Windows 95 Features
Windows 95 Features
▶
About Windows 95
▼
Using Windows 95 Features
▶
Device I/O Control
▶
Exclusive Volume Locking
▶
FAT32 File System
▶
Long Filenames
▶
MS-DOS Extensions
▼
Thunk Compiler
▼
About the Thunk Compiler
▶
Role of the Thunk Compiler
▼
Thunk Compiler and Data Types
Data Types Supported By the Thunk Compiler
Handling Data Types Not Supported by the Thunk Compiler
Supported and Unsupported Return Values
Supported and Unsupported Calling Conventions
Behavior of Win32 Functions Inside 16-Bit Processes
Compatibility with Existing 16-Bit DLLs
16- to 32-Bit Thunks and Preemption
16- to 32-Bit Thunks in GDI Device Drivers
Globally Fixing Handles
Late Loading
▶
Using the Thunk Compiler
▶
Troubleshooting Flat Thunks
▶
Virtual Machine Services
▶
Windows 95 Service Control Manager
▶
Windows 95 Reference
▶
Windows NT Features
▶
Reference
▶
SDK Documentation
▶
DDK Documentation
▶
Windows Resource Kits
▶
Specifications
▶
Knowledge Base
▶
Technical Articles
▶
Backgrounders
▶
Books
▶
Partial Books
▶
Periodicals
▶
Conference Papers